Nelle Form devi distinguere in che Modalità di Visualizzazione stai operando, perchè se usi la Visualizzazione in Maschera Singola hai 2 possibilità, mentre se operi in Maschera Continua, solo 1.
Nel Report invece ne hai sempre 2, ma personalmente ne uso solo 1.
Riassumo:
Form
1) Maschera Singola
a)Formattazione Condizionale, inserendo come Metodo di applicazione della Formattazione "L'Espressione è" poi nel criterio inserirai quello che hai appena detto.
b)Su Evento Current scrivi 2 righe di codice(io preferisco questa perchè non ha limitazioni)
Private Sub Form_Current()
If not Me.NewRecord then
If (Criterio di Evidenza) Then
Me.NomeControllo.BackColor=vbRed
Else
Me.NomeControllo.BackColor=vbWhite
End if
End if
End Sub
2) Maschera Continua, hai solo la Formattazione condizionale, si usa come al punto 1.a
Report
Hai la situazione uguale alla Maschera Singola, e come per quella io userei il codice, il medesimo ma su Evento Format della Sezione in cui si trova il controllo(bada a non valutarlo in modalità LayOut ma solo in Anteprima).
Saluti